チェーンリンク(LINK)スマートコントラクトでできる革新的な活用例
ブロックチェーン技術の進化は、金融、サプライチェーン、保険など、様々な産業に変革をもたらす可能性を秘めています。その中でも、スマートコントラクトは、契約の自動化と透明性の向上を実現する重要な要素として注目されています。しかし、スマートコントラクトは、外部データへのアクセスに制限があるという課題を抱えていました。この課題を解決するために登場したのが、チェーンリンク(LINK)です。本稿では、チェーンリンクの概要と、そのスマートコントラクトを活用した革新的な活用例について詳細に解説します。
1. チェーンリンク(LINK)とは
チェーンリンクは、ブロックチェーンと現実世界のデータを安全かつ信頼性の高い方法で接続するための分散型オラクルネットワークです。オラクルとは、ブロックチェーン外部のデータ(価格情報、天気情報、イベント結果など)をスマートコントラクトに提供する役割を担うものです。従来のオラクルは、単一の信頼主体に依存するため、データの改ざんや不正のリスクがありました。チェーンリンクは、複数の独立したノード(オラクルノード)が連携してデータを検証し、集約することで、データの信頼性を高めています。
1.1 チェーンリンクの仕組み
チェーンリンクの仕組みは、以下のステップで構成されます。
- リクエスト: スマートコントラクトが外部データのリクエストをチェーンリンクネットワークに送信します。
- ノード選択: チェーンリンクネットワークは、リクエストされたデータを提供するのに適したノードを選択します。ノードの選択は、評判、セキュリティ、データソースの信頼性などの要素に基づいて行われます。
- データ取得: 選択されたノードは、外部データソースからデータを取得します。
- データ集約: 複数のノードから取得されたデータは、集約され、単一の信頼できるデータセットが生成されます。
- データ提供: 集約されたデータは、スマートコントラクトに提供されます。
1.2 LINKトークンの役割
チェーンリンクネットワークのネイティブトークンであるLINKは、以下の役割を果たします。
- ノードのインセンティブ: ノードは、正確なデータを提供することでLINKトークンを獲得できます。
- リクエストの支払い: スマートコントラクトは、データリクエストを行う際にLINKトークンを支払う必要があります。
- ネットワークのセキュリティ: LINKトークンは、ネットワークのセキュリティを維持するために使用されます。
2. チェーンリンクを活用した革新的な活用例
2.1 金融分野
金融分野では、チェーンリンクは、DeFi(分散型金融)アプリケーションの基盤として重要な役割を果たしています。以下に、具体的な活用例を示します。
- 価格フィード: チェーンリンクの価格フィードは、暗号資産の価格情報を正確かつ信頼性の高い方法でスマートコントラクトに提供します。これにより、レンディングプラットフォーム、DEX(分散型取引所)、合成資産プラットフォームなどのDeFiアプリケーションは、適切な価格に基づいて取引や計算を行うことができます。
- 安定コイン: チェーンリンクは、法定通貨や他の資産にペッグされた安定コインの価格を維持するために使用されます。
- 保険: チェーンリンクは、気象データやフライトデータなどの外部データに基づいて、保険契約の自動化を実現します。例えば、特定の気象条件が満たされた場合に、自動的に保険金が支払われるような仕組みを構築できます。
2.2 サプライチェーン管理
サプライチェーン管理において、チェーンリンクは、製品の追跡、品質管理、支払いの自動化などを実現します。以下に、具体的な活用例を示します。
- 製品の追跡: チェーンリンクは、製品の製造から配送までの過程をブロックチェーン上に記録し、透明性の高いサプライチェーンを実現します。
- 品質管理: チェーンリンクは、温度、湿度、衝撃などのデータをブロックチェーン上に記録し、製品の品質を保証します。
- 支払いの自動化: チェーンリンクは、製品の配送完了などの条件が満たされた場合に、自動的に支払いを実行します。
2.3 ゲーム業界
ゲーム業界では、チェーンリンクは、ゲーム内のアイテムの所有権の証明、ランダム性の確保、不正行為の防止などに使用されます。以下に、具体的な活用例を示します。
- NFT(非代替性トークン): チェーンリンクは、ゲーム内のアイテムをNFTとして発行し、プレイヤーがアイテムの所有権を証明できるようにします。
- ランダム性: チェーンリンクのVRF(検証可能なランダム関数)は、ゲーム内のイベントの結果を公平かつ予測不可能に決定するために使用されます。
- 不正行為の防止: チェーンリンクは、ゲーム内の不正行為を検出し、防止するために使用されます。
2.4 不動産
不動産分野では、チェーンリンクは、不動産の所有権の移転、賃貸契約の自動化、不動産投資の透明性向上などに活用できます。以下に、具体的な活用例を示します。
- 不動産の所有権の移転: チェーンリンクは、不動産の所有権をトークン化し、ブロックチェーン上で安全かつ効率的に移転できるようにします。
- 賃貸契約の自動化: チェーンリンクは、賃貸契約の条件が満たされた場合に、自動的に賃料を支払う仕組みを構築します。
- 不動産投資の透明性向上: チェーンリンクは、不動産投資に関する情報をブロックチェーン上に記録し、透明性を向上させます。
2.5 その他
上記以外にも、チェーンリンクは、様々な分野で活用できます。例えば、以下のような活用例が考えられます。
- 選挙: チェーンリンクは、選挙結果の改ざんを防止し、透明性の高い選挙を実現します。
- 医療: チェーンリンクは、患者の医療データを安全に管理し、医療機関間のデータ共有を促進します。
- エネルギー: チェーンリンクは、エネルギーの生産量や消費量をブロックチェーン上に記録し、エネルギー取引の透明性を向上させます。
3. チェーンリンクの課題と今後の展望
チェーンリンクは、スマートコントラクトの可能性を広げる革新的な技術ですが、いくつかの課題も抱えています。例えば、ノードの分散化の促進、データソースの多様化、スケーラビリティの向上などが挙げられます。これらの課題を解決するために、チェーンリンクの開発チームは、継続的に技術開発を進めています。
今後の展望としては、チェーンリンクは、より多くの産業で活用され、スマートコントラクトの普及を加速させることが期待されます。また、チェーンリンクは、他のブロックチェーン技術との連携を強化し、より複雑なアプリケーションの開発を可能にすると考えられます。さらに、チェーンリンクは、Web3.0の基盤技術として、分散型インターネットの実現に貢献することが期待されます。
4. まとめ
チェーンリンクは、ブロックチェーンと現実世界のデータを安全かつ信頼性の高い方法で接続するための分散型オラクルネットワークです。チェーンリンクを活用することで、スマートコントラクトは、外部データへのアクセスが可能になり、金融、サプライチェーン、ゲーム、不動産など、様々な分野で革新的な活用例が生まれています。チェーンリンクは、今後のブロックチェーン技術の発展において、ますます重要な役割を果たすことが期待されます。